Output 9f103f80efd866a288a3be2836eddb01b95a8c085b487c5526d407ea1728d105:3

value
592112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ad30fedb45c07bf02afdebbd807ace96ee9a9870 OP_EQUAL
address
3HUmWzwRW3chScqeQcaVSSRoWRoZeqDmjd
transaction
9f103f80efd866a288a3be2836eddb01b95a8c085b487c5526d407ea1728d105
spent
true